    Lakers' Nick Smith: Leads all scorers in G League

    Smith collected 24 points (11-19 FG, 1-7 3Pt, 1-2 FT), two rebounds, six assists and one steal in 28 minutes during Wednesday's 113-99 G League win over the Valley Suns.

    Despite coming off the bench, Smith was still able to lead all scorers Wednesday. The two-way player has made just one appearance at the NBA level since Feb. 3, with Smith averaging 19.5 points, 4.0 assists, 2.8 rebounds and 2.5 three-pointers in 30.4 minutes per game through six G League outings in 2025-26.

  • Jazz's Lauri Markkanen: Deemed questionable for Thursday

    Markkanen (ankle/hip) is questionable for Thursday's game against the Pelicans, Ben Anderson of KSL News Salt Lake City reports.

    Markkanen sprained his right ankle and sustained a right hip impingement during Wednesday's practice. He underwent an MRi shortly after, and his questionable designation likely means he avoided serious injury. Still, it wouldn't be surprising for Markannen to need a game or two off to recover.

    Jazz's Keyonte George: Questionable for Thursday

    George (ankle) is questionable for Thursday's game against the Pelicans, Ben Anderson of KSL News Salt Lake City reports.

    George has missed the past five games for the Jazz, but there's a chance he'll be able to get back out there Thursday evening. If George is cleared to return, Isaiah Collier would likely return to the second unit.

    Cavaliers' Jaylon Tyson: Moves into starting lineup

    Tyson is in Cleveland's starting lineup against Milwaukee on Wednesday.

    The Cavaliers are rolling out a new-look starting five Wednesday due to the absences of Evan Mobley (foot), James Harden (thumb) and Donovan Mitchell (groin). Tyson started in 14 consecutive games between Jan. 14 and Feb. 11, and over that span he averaged 16.6 points, 5.6 rebounds, 3.2 assists and 2.6 threes over 29.8 minutes per game.

  • Cavaliers' Dennis Schroder: Starting sans Harden

    Schroder is part of the Cavs' starting lineup for Wednesday's game against Milwaukee.

    Schroder will step into the starting lineup Wednesday night due to the absence of James Harden (thumb). In eight games with the Cavaliers, Schroder is averaging 8.0 points, 4.1 assists, 2.3 rebounds and 1.5 steals across 20.3 minutes. Wednesday's game will be his first start for Cleveland.

    Cavaliers' Sam Merrill: Back in starting five

    Merrill is in the Cavaliers' starting lineup against the Bucks on Wednesday.

    The Cavaliers are missing Donovan Mitchell (groin), James Harden (thumb) and Evan Mobley (calf) for Wednesday's game, so Merrill will enter the starting lineup alongside Dennis Schroder, Jaylon Tyson, Dean Wade and Jarrett Allen. It'll be Merrill's 24th start of the season and ninth in 12 games for Cleveland. His last start took place Friday in a 118-113 win over the Hornets, when he logged 10 points, two rebounds and two assists over 24 minutes.

    Grizzlies' Javon Small: First NBA start Wednesday

    Small is in the Grizzlies' starting lineup against the Warriors on Wednesday.

    Small will be in the starting lineup Wednesday for the first time in his career. He's coming off a strong performance against the Kings on Monday, when he logged 21 points, nine assists and six rebounds over 25 minutes. Small has played 20-plus minutes in each of his last eight outings and will have the opportunity to take on an expanded role against Golden State.
